#6e84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e84ca is composed of 43.1% red, 51.8%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 34.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 61.2%. #6e84ca color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#000995.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6e84ca color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#6e84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6e84ca has RGB values of R:110, G:132,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 7242954.

Shades and Tints of #6e84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e84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9c9c is the less saturated color, while #406cf8 is the most saturated one.
